What COOs and Senior Leadership Evaluate in Operations Manager Resumes

Operations management hiring is metric-driven to an extreme. COOs evaluating resumes want to see specific operational KPIs: throughput improvements, cost reductions (as a percentage and dollar amount), quality metrics (defect rates, SLA compliance), and team productivity gains. If your resume describes 'managing daily operations' without quantifiable results, it signals a coordinator role dressed up with a manager title.

Cross-functional leadership distinguishes operations managers from operations supervisors. The ability to coordinate across supply chain, finance, HR, and IT to drive process improvements is what makes operations managers valuable at the organizational level. If you have led cross-departmental initiatives, managed vendor relationships worth seven figures, or implemented ERP systems, those are the experiences that signal readiness for senior operations roles.

Process improvement methodology is expected, not optional. Lean, Six Sigma, or Theory of Constraints experience is now baseline for mid-level operations roles. But the methodology matters less than the results. A candidate who reduced order fulfillment time by 40% using basic process mapping is more compelling than one with a Six Sigma Black Belt who cannot cite a single project outcome. Lead with results, then mention the methodology.

Phrases That Get Operations Managers Rejected

Managed daily operations and ensured smooth running of the department.

Describes a job, not an achievement. Every operations manager runs daily operations. ATS sees zero differentiating metrics.

Directed operations across 3 facilities with $28M annual output, achieving 99.4% on-time delivery and reducing operational downtime by 22%.

Led process improvement initiatives to increase efficiency.

'Increase efficiency' without numbers is meaningless. What methodology? How much improvement? What cost savings?

Led 8 Lean Six Sigma (DMAIC) projects that eliminated $1.2M in annual waste, reduced cycle time by 30%, and improved first-pass yield to 97.5%.

Experienced in managing budgets and teams.

Self-assessment without proof. ATS needs specific numbers: team size, budget value, and outcomes.

Managed a 45-person team with a $3.5M annual budget, implementing workforce scheduling that reduced overtime costs by 28% while maintaining 98% staffing coverage.

Improved warehouse operations and order fulfillment.

No facility size, no volume, no accuracy metric. This could describe any warehouse role.

Managed a 120K sq. ft. distribution center processing 5,000+ daily orders, improving order accuracy from 96.2% to 99.1% through WMS optimization.

Worked on inventory optimization projects.

'Worked on' is passive. What system? What was the financial impact? What changed?

Implemented a demand-driven replenishment system in SAP, reducing excess inventory by $800K (35%) and improving turnover from 4.2x to 6.8x annually.

Strong leadership skills with a focus on operational excellence.

Subjective claims are unmeasurable and appear on most rejected resumes. Show the operational excellence with data.

Developed a standardized training program for 30+ associates, reducing onboarding time by 52% and decreasing new-hire error rates by 60%.
